Baked Seasoned Fries
¼ Cup parmesan cheese
I Tablespoon olive oil
1 Tablespoon basil
1/2 teaspoon seasoning salt
4 medium Potatoes, cut in fries

Preheat the oven to 425.
Cut potatoes into thin fries.
Place potato fries on cookie sheet.
 Toss oil and seasonings together and toss over potato fries.
Bake 425 for 15-20 minutes. Or until crispy and golden.
